  1. Model 1: univariate; Model 2: adjusted for age, sex and body mass index; Model 3: adjusted each factor for model 2 plus cyanosis, previous sternotomy, STAT mortality category and cardiopulmonary bypass time
  2. Retinal vessel density is divided into two categories according to cut-off points at the point of maximal sum of sensitivity and specificity using the receiver operating characteristic (ROC) curve
  3. Abbreviations: RPC, radial peripapillary capillary; SCP, superficial capillary plexus; DCP, deep capillary plexus; OR, odds ratio; CI, confidence intervals; STAT, Society of Thoracic Surgeons-European Association for Cardio-Thoracic Surgery
